The Detroit Tigers host the Cleveland Guardians in an MLB matchup at Comerica Park. Starting pitchers are Slade Cecconi (0-1, 5.40 ERA) for Cleveland and Jackson Jobe (4-0, 4.12 ERA) for Detroit. Both are right-handed and making their first career starts against the opposing team. The Tigers hold a better overall season record (33-18) compared to the Guardians (27-22) and enter as favorites with home advantage.

The Minnesota Twins host the Cleveland Guardians in an MLB matchup at Target Field. The Twins come in with a 26-21 record while the Guardians hold a 25-21 mark. Both teams have shown competitive balance this season with similar win-loss records and moderate offensive production. The pitching matchup features Gavin Williams (Guardians) against Joe Ryan (Twins), both of whom have had respectable seasons and moderate success against each other.

Minnesota Twins have a solid season record of 26-21, with balanced offense and pitching. Cleveland Guardians are close behind at 25-21 and have a pitching staff with a 4.14 ERA and 1.41 WHIP. Guardians batters have struggled somewhat with a .233 average but have key contributors like Steven Kwan and Jose Ramirez driving runs.
Gavin Williams, the Guardians' starter, is 2-2 with a 3.79 ERA historically against the Twins. Joe Ryan for the Twins is experienced and has produced steady performances. The teams have been evenly matched, reflected in nearly equal win probabilities (51% Twins vs 49% Guardians).

The Milwaukee Brewers are visiting the Cleveland Guardians at Progressive Field in a closely contested MLB matchup. Both teams have shown competitive form, with the Guardians holding a slightly better record (25-17) compared to the Brewers (20-23). The game is set to start at 1:10 PM ET (17:10 UTC), with pitchers Gavin Williams (Guardians) and Louie Henderson (Brewers) expected to start. The Cleveland Guardians have a stronger recent record and pitching performance, notably with Gavin Williams posting a 4.38 ERA and good recent outings. The Brewers have struggled somewhat with a 20-23 record but have been competitive in run lines. Guardians have dominated earlier games in the series, winning by multiple runs and keeping Brewers scoreless in those.
In the current series, the Guardians have won the first two games decisively, including a 5-0 and 2-0 scoreline. This shows a recent upper hand at both pitching and offense for Cleveland against Milwaukee.
